1182, Caere

  • Record number: 1182
  • Site: Caere
  • Roof element: Appliqué
  • Comparanda: Cerveteri 16396
  • Remarks: Small Gorgoneion in relief with flat back, with 2 nail holes (Diam 0.4) obliquely through back, below each ear.
  • Bibliography: Andrén 1940, pp. 35-36, No. II:15, Pl. 10:36
  • Publication record: Architectural terracottas from Etrusco-Italic Temples. Author: Andrén, A.. Place of publication: Lund/Leipzig. Publication Date: 1939-1940
  • Type of decoration: Gorgoneion
  • Last Recorded Collection: Museo Nazionale Etrusco di Villa Giulia
  • Mouldmade: yes
  • Height: 11
  • Width: 11.7
  • MPD: 5.3
  • Clay: 7.5YR 7/6
  • Paint: Cream slip on face 10YR 8/3, purple-red 7.5R 4/6 on wavy hair across forehead, stripe on tp of head near back edge, 2 hair strands below right ear, retina, upper lip, tongue; brown 7.5YR 5/4 large disk earrings; black knobs across top of head (overpainted blue 5BG 7/1), inside of ear, eyebrows, lids, pupil & outline of retina
  • Condition: Irregular scar across top from missing part; broken across bottom
  • Height face: 7.6
  • Distance outer eyes: 5.5
  • Width nose bottom: 1.6
  • Width mouth: 2.9
